Overview

Young Nails Core Acrylic Powder 85g lands squarely in the professional-grade tier, and it shows the moment you scoop it onto your brush. This is the Core line in the French Pink shade, an 85g jar that should last a solo tech through plenty of full sets. What stands out right away is the self-leveling formula—it settles into place on the nail rather than sitting in a stubborn clump that needs constant coaxing. Young Nails has built a solid reputation among salon professionals over the years, and this powder feels like it's made with that audience in mind first, with home users as a welcome second group. It's not a flashy product, but it doesn't need to be.

Features & Benefits

The exact particle blend is the real story here. In practice, this acrylic powder spreads more evenly than budget alternatives, which means less time spent buffing down ridges and high spots afterward. It sets in roughly 90 seconds under normal working conditions, though anyone who's worked in a chilly salon in winter knows that number can shift a bit depending on room temperature. The self-leveling quality genuinely helps during sculpting—there's a noticeable difference in how the bead settles compared to powders that fight you. As for the French Pink tone, it reads as a soft, natural pink rather than something too white or chalky, which gives finished nails a clean, wearable look. Adhesion has held up well in testing too.

User Feedback

Feedback on this nail powder tends to circle around the same themes. People consistently mention how smooth and self-leveling it feels compared to what they used before, calling it a real time-saver during application. The French Pink shade gets praise for looking soft and believable rather than artificial—though a few buyers expected something slightly different and had to adjust their color expectations. On the downside, some note that results seem best when paired specifically with Young Nails monomer, and mixing brands can be less predictable. Pros who order repeatedly also point out that jar-to-jar consistency has stayed reliable, which matters a lot when you're trying to match previous work.

Specifications

  • Brand: This powder is made by Young Nails, a company well known among professional nail technicians.
  • Product Line: It belongs to the Core line, which is designed for sculpting full sets and fills.
  • Color: The shade is French Pink, a soft natural pink rather than a stark white-pink.
  • Net Weight: Each jar contains 85g of acrylic powder.
  • Format: The product comes as a loose acrylic powder for use with liquid monomer.
  • Formula Type: It uses a self-leveling formula that settles smoothly during application.
  • Particle Technology: Young Nails uses exact particle blend technology to promote even spreading.
  • Setting Time: Under normal conditions, it sets in approximately 90 seconds.
  • Adhesion Quality: The formula is designed for professional-grade adhesion to support long-lasting extensions.
  • Item Model Number: The model number for this product is PC085FP.
  • UPC: The UPC for this product is 810263010155.
  • Manufacturer: This product is manufactured by The Regatta Group, doing business as Beauty Depot.
  • Intended Users: It is suitable for both professional nail technicians and experienced at-home users.
  • Compatible System: Best results are typically achieved when paired with Young Nails liquid monomer.
  • Storage: Like most acrylic powders, it should be stored in a sealed container away from direct sunlight and moisture.
